I beta tested the AirSine. Here's my advise... DO NOT ALLOW THIS POWER CORD INTO YOUR HOME. Unless, that is, you want to be disappointed with your existing power cord. I was stunned at the difference between this cord and the two I had on hand---- the flavor 1 and the Transparent Powerlink XL20amp PC. I used these cords primarily with my CD player (Resolution Audio Opus 21) and briefly with a VTL 5.5 preamp. I am by no means an expert on the subject of power cords. I entered the beta testing period fully prepared to send back the AirSine because it would prove to be a very miniscule difference. But this cable did more for the music than I was prepared to believe. The cord will not leave my house anytime soon.

The AirSine is indeed very flexible and this is a plus with my system configuration. I am not a longtime customer of VH audio products. In fact, I was quite skeptical of the whole power cord thing. I believed all the posts here on Audiogon about they're importance, however I thought that most were using hyperbole to a large extent when descibing their particular PC favorite.
